Who is Bart Rozum?

Bart Rozum is a character connected to Damage Control, Marvel's fictional construction company responsible for cleaning up the collateral destruction left behind by superhero battles and conflicts in the Marvel Universe.

Bart Rozum is a Marvel character who made his debut in the pages of Marvel Age Annual #4 in 1988, brought to life by the legendary pairing of Chris Claremont and John Buscema β€” a creative team that alone makes that first appearance a collector's conversation piece. A product of the Copper Age, Rozum found his niche in the world of Damage Control, Marvel's wonderfully offbeat corner of the universe where the aftermath of superhero chaos becomes its own kind of adventure. Over a publishing span stretching nearly two decades, he shares the page with a cast of distinctly human characters β€” Lenny Ballinger, Robin Chapel, Albert Cleary, and others β€” grounding him firmly in that blue-collar, behind-the-scenes Marvel milieu that fans of the series absolutely treasure. With appearances across WWH Aftersmash: Damage Control and a key-issue credit to his name, Rozum is a rewarding find for readers who love discovering the quieter, cleverer side of the Marvel Universe.
